5 AMP Fuses
5A fuses are used in older equipment, most manufacturers have now standardised plus and fuse ratings to be either 3A or 13A.
What are fuses used for?
Fuses are safety devices designed to protect the electrical cable of the appliance rather than the appliance itself. Fuses are deliberately the weak link in a circuit and will blow' if an appliance or cable draws too much power, to prevent a fire occurring.
You should also only replace a 5A fuse with another 5A fuse. If the fuse continues to blow do not put a higher amperage fuse in, check and correct the reason for the fuse blowing in the first place.
